Lights, Camera, Market Street: “RJ Decker” to Shoot in ILM

WECT A new TV series, “RJ Decker,” will film at The Suites on Market in Wilmington on Wednesday, Feb. 25, bringing more than 130 cast and crew members to the area. Production includes 35 cast members, 85 crew members and 10 extras, with filming scheduled from 9 a.m. to 11 p.m. both inside and outside the hotel. Streetlights may be temporarily shut off for night scenes, and a police officer will be on site for security. Backup filming dates are set for Feb. 26 or 27.

NC Lawmakers Weigh Property Tax Relief as Homeowner Costs Rise

WECT North Carolina lawmakers are studying potential property tax relief options as rising home assessments strain residents and local governments. Ideas discussed include capping annual tax increases and requiring voter approval for certain hikes, though no formal bills have been filed. Officials also warned that possible federal funding cuts could shift more financial pressure onto municipalities, potentially complicating efforts to lower taxes.

A New Hanover County Sheriff’s deputy resigned after being arrested and charged with DUI in Carolina Beach, where he was allegedly driving 60 mph in a 35 mph zone and registered a .25 BAC — more than three times the legal limit. Deputy Eric Paul Williams stepped down two days after his January arrest; his case remains pending in county court. WHQR

The City of Wilmington has taken its public-facing media mailbox system offline as a precaution following recent cyberattacks in the Cape Fear region. Officials say there has been no breach of the city’s system, but the move comes after nearly $488,000 was stolen from Carolina Beach in December and more than $650,000 was taken from Pender County in a separate scam. A former Wilmington police officer was sentenced to 30 days in jail and one year of probation after pleading guilty to hitting his girlfriend with a car while driving impaired, entering an Alford plea in the 2023 case. Darryl Warren will begin serving his sentence Feb. 20 and is subject to a no-contact order, while several other charges against him were dismissed. WECT

The Supreme Court struck down most of former President Donald Trump’s sweeping tariffs, ruling 6-3 that he exceeded his authority by using a national emergency law to impose them, dealing a significant setback to his administration. The court held that the 1977 International Emergency Economic Powers Act does not authorize presidents to unilaterally implement tariffs, with Chief Justice John Roberts writing the majority opinion. Actor Eric Dane has died at 53 following a battle with ALS, his family confirmed, saying he passed away surrounded by loved ones after becoming an advocate for awareness and research during his illness. The “Grey’s Anatomy” star publicly revealed his diagnosis in April 2025 after a lengthy search for answers. TMZ
